This course is for anyone who wants to improve their skills in Windows Server Administration. This course will teach you from the basics to advance topics of installing, configuring and managing a windows server. I wanted to focus on real world scenarios. Something that emulates a real network with a server and a client computer. That’s what I chose Hyper-V as the hypervisor for the virtual lab and Windows Server 2022 and Windows 11 as the Server – client computers. Many of the task in System Administration consist on configuring client – server applications and services. In order to gain competence as a Systems Administrator you have to practice configuring and managing difference services and set the client computer to communicate with the server, that is the bread and butter of a systems administrator. Most of the call you will face when supporting servers and clients computers will involve that scenario, where there’s a client communicating to an application or service running on the server. That’s why I decided to create this course to cover from the basics to more advance topics. By the end of this course you will gain competence in performing the most essential task of Windows System Administration.
